Possible Risks and Considerations
The primary challenge when using offshore bookmakers is the lack of UKGC oversight and safeguards. Players lose access to the UK’s dispute resolution mechanisms, and there’s no guarantee of account protection if the bookmaker encounters financial problems or disputes arise regarding account balances, payouts, or terms and conditions.
Furthermore, these platforms may lack robust responsible gambling tools, making it easier for vulnerable players to develop harmful wagering patterns. Tax implications may vary as well, and while international betting returns are generally tax-free for UK residents, players should check their tax responsibilities. Customer support quality can vary significantly, and payout speeds may be longer compared to established UK-licensed betting operators.
